Why Traditional Methods Fall Short
Most people reach for household solutions like vinegar, rubbing alcohol, or baking soda—often ending up with discolored fabrics or incomplete removal. Oil-based paints resist water-based cleaners, while alcohol can damage synthetic fabrics. Vinegar might work on fabrics ink but fails on oil paints due to poor solvency.

The Ultra-Fast Paint Removal Formula: Hot Water + Dish Soap + Baking Soda
The ultimate quick fix combines three simple ingredients in a powerful but safe trio:
1. Hot Water—Your First Fast Action
Immediately rinse the painted area with hot (not boiling) water. Hot water breaks down the paint’s outer layer and activates detergents, making separation easier. Avoid cold water—it sets paint faster.
2. Strong Grease-Fighting Dish Soap
Apply a generous layer of liquid dish soap directly to the stain. Dish soap works as a surfactant, cutting through paint chemicals and lifting them from the fabric. Let it sit for 10–15 minutes while preparing the final agent.

3. Baking Soda Paste for Deep Residue
Create a paste by mixing baking soda with water. Apply it generously over the stained area. Leave it on for at least 20 minutes—this alkaline mixture breaks down stubborn chemical bonds without textile damage. Then rinse thoroughly.
Step-by-Step Quick Fix Routine (Emergency Paint Removal)
Step 1: Cool the Paint Jam (If Burning Sensation Still Exists)
If the paint is still warm, blot with a damp cloth to prevent spreading—but wait before scrubbing hard.
Step 2: Rinse with Hot Water
Run the stained cloth under hot tap water, focusing on the paint mark. Repeat until you see stains lifting.
Step 3: Apply Dish Soap Barrier
Dab dish soap across the stain to dissolve paint solvents. Blot gently with a clean cloth.
Step 4: Spread Baking Soda Paste
Make a thick paste and press onto the stain. Let it cake for 15–20 minutes.
Step 5: Scrub and Rinse
Using a soft brush or cloth, gently scrub the area. Rinse completely with hot water until no residue remains.
Step 6: Dry Flat to Set
Smother the garment under a towel and let air-dry—no heat until fully dry to avoid set-in stains.
